The Nisqually Indian Tribe is developing a Medicine Assisted Treatment (MAT) facility on Pacific Ave in Olympia, Washington to address the opioid crisis within the Thurston County Area. The Nisqually Indian Tribe is passionate about developing a whole person recovery model - keeping all the services under one roof – so the patient has the best possible chance of recovery. Our goal is to bring healing and wellness to the community, focusing on the entire family by serving tribal and non-tribal patients.
